sawine@0: %% start of file `moderncvcompatibility.sty'. sawine@0: %% Copyright 2006-2008 Xavier Danaux (xdanaux@gmail.com). sawine@0: % sawine@0: % This work may be distributed and/or modified under the sawine@0: % conditions of the LaTeX Project Public License version 1.3c, sawine@0: % available at http://www.latex-project.org/lppl/. sawine@0: sawine@0: sawine@0: %------------------------------------------------------------------------------- sawine@0: % identification sawine@0: %------------------------------------------------------------------------------- sawine@0: \NeedsTeXFormat{LaTeX2e} sawine@0: \ProvidesPackage{moderncvcompatibility}[2008/06/17 v0.7 modern curriculum vitae compatibility patches] sawine@0: sawine@0: sawine@0: %------------------------------------------------------------------------------- sawine@0: % required packages sawine@0: %------------------------------------------------------------------------------- sawine@0: sawine@0: sawine@0: %------------------------------------------------------------------------------- sawine@0: % package options sawine@0: %------------------------------------------------------------------------------- sawine@0: % old casual option (version 0.1) sawine@0: %\DeclareOption{casual}{\input{moderncvstylecasual.sty}} sawine@0: sawine@0: % old classic option (version 0.1) sawine@0: %\DeclareOption{classic}{\input{moderncvstyleclassic.sty}} sawine@0: sawine@0: \DeclareOption*{} sawine@0: sawine@0: % process given options sawine@0: \ProcessOptions\relax sawine@0: sawine@0: %------------------------------------------------------------------------------- sawine@0: % definitions sawine@0: %------------------------------------------------------------------------------- sawine@0: % compatibility with version 0.1 sawine@0: \newcommand*{\cvresume}[2]{\cvlistdoubleitem{#1}{#2}} sawine@0: sawine@0: % compatibility with versions <= 0.2 sawine@0: % section, cvline, ... with width argument... sawine@0: %\newcommand*{\section}[2][0.825]{% sawine@0: % \closesection{}% sawine@0: % \@sectionopentrue% sawine@0: % \addcontentsline{toc}{part}{#2} sawine@0: % \begin{longtable}[t]{@{}r@{\hspace{.025\textwidth}}@{}p{#1\textwidth}@{}}% sawine@0: %% \colorrule{.15\textwidth}&\mbox{\color{sectiontitlecolor}\sectionfont#2}\\[1ex]}% sawine@0: % {\color{sectionrectanglecolor}\rule{0.15\textwidth}{1ex}}&\mbox{\color{sectiontitlecolor}\sectionfont#2}\\[1ex]}% sawine@0: %\newcommand*{\cvline}[3][.825]{% sawine@0: % \begin{minipage}[t]{\hintscolumnwidth}\raggedleft\small\sffamily#2\end{minipage}&\begin{minipage}[t]{\maincolumnwidth}#3\end{minipage}\\} sawine@0: %\newcommand*{\cvitem}[3][.825]{% sawine@0: % \cvline[#1]{#2}{#3\vspace*{.75em}}} % the \vspace*{} inside the cvline environment is a hack... (should conceptually be outside the environment) sawine@0: sawine@0: % compatibility with versions <= 0.5 sawine@0: \newcommand*{\cvitem}[2]{\cvline{#1}{#2}} sawine@0: \newcommand*{\moderncvstyle}[1]{\moderncvtheme{#1}} sawine@0: sawine@0: % compatibility with versions <=0.7 sawine@0: \newcommand*{\closesection}{} sawine@0: \newcommand*{\emptysection}{} sawine@0: \newcommand*{\sethintscolumnlength}[1]{% sawine@0: \setlength{\hintscolumnwidth}{#1}% sawine@0: \recomputelengths} sawine@0: \newcommand*{\sethintscolumntowidth}[1]{% sawine@0: \settowidth{\hintscolumnwidth}{#1}% sawine@0: \recomputelengths} sawine@0: sawine@0: \endinput sawine@0: sawine@0: sawine@0: %% end of file `moderncvcompatibility.sty'.